Business advantages of Service-Oriented Architecture
Explain the business advantages of the Service-Oriented Architecture.
Expert
a) SOA may help businesses respond more rapidly and economically for changing the market conditions.
b) SOA may be considered as an architectural evolution. It captures many of the best practices of the previous software architectures.
c) The goal of separating the users from service implementations is promoted by the SOA.
d) The goals such as increased federation, increased interoperability, and increased business and technology domain alignment may be achieved by the SOA because of its architectural and design discipline.
e) SOA refers to an architectural approach for constructing the complex software-intensive systems from services.
